TL;DR Summary

Battles continue in Khartoum as envoys from Sudan's warring parties are in Saudi Arabia for talks that mediators hope will end the three-week-old conflict. The UNHCR has registered more than 30,000 people crossing into South Sudan, and at least 700 people have been killed in the fighting. Saudi Arabia will allocate $100m in humanitarian aid to Sudan, but the ceasefire talks have yielded "no major progress" so far. Western powers have backed the transition to a civilian government, but heavyweights in the pan-Arab bloc are divided on Sudan.
